Tributyl Phosphate (TBP) from China

TBP functions both as extractive solvent and secondary plasticizer in cellulose acetate and nitrocellulose coatings. Under HTS 2919.90.50.10 when specified for plasticizer use, this trialkyl phosphate provides rapid solvency. Common in nail polish and printing ink formulations.
